| Abstract: | The purpose of this paper is to inform novice science teachers and science teacher educators of the pedagogy that science teacher supervisors value. As expert practitioners, supervisors have a perspective quite different from that of both novice teachers and teacher educators. Nine inservice science teacher supervisors assessed a novice teacher's videotaped lesson on mitosis. Their teaching experience ranged from 5 to 30 years and their supervisory experience ranged from 4 to 16 years. Five supervisors were certified as school administrators while seven had taught high school biology. The supervisors were individually interviewed within one day of viewing the videotape. The supervisors addressed 19 different aspects of the lesson. All valued indirect, activity-centered instructional methods over direct, teacher-centered approaches; small groups as an efficient arrangement for managing activity-centered instruction; classroom routines as an efficient way to effect regular procedures and hold students accountable for meeting expectations; and teachers who could engender cooperation in their students. The supervisors still expected teachers to transmit, albeit indirectly, the body of knowledge specified by an external curricular authority and to evaluate students' attempts to copy that knowledge correctly. Implications for teacher educators are discussed. Contains 25 references. (PVD) |
